Key Features to Consider When Choosing Solar Thermal Panels
Choosing the right solar thermal panels is crucial for maximizing energy efficiency. Key features play a significant role in this decision. Look for panels with high thermal efficiency ratings. This rating indicates how well the panel converts sunlight into usable heat. Higher ratings typically mean better performance in varying weather conditions.
Consider the materials used in the panels. Select those made of durable substances that can withstand environmental wear and tear. Corrosion resistance is also important. Less durable panels may lead to more frequent replacements. Installation requirements vary, so ensure you know what’s needed for your specific space.
Pay attention to the warranty offered. A longer warranty often signifies manufacturers' confidence in their product. Short warranties can be a red flag. Also, review customer feedback cautiously. Some negative reviews may highlight common issues. Addressing these could prevent future problems. Ultimately, thorough research is essential to find the best solar thermal panels for your needs.

Cost-Benefit Analysis of Solar Thermal Panels for Global Markets
As the demand for renewable energy grows, solar thermal panels are gaining traction in global markets. According to a recent forecast by the International Renewable Energy Agency (IRENA), the market for solar thermal technology is expected to expand significantly, driven by favorable government policies and decreasing costs. In 2022, the average installation cost for solar thermal systems was approximately $300 per square meter. This figure is projected to fall further, making these systems more attractive to consumers.
The cost-benefit analysis highlights several critical factors. For instance, homeowners can expect an average return on investment (ROI) of 15-20% over the lifespan of solar thermal panels, which can exceed 20 years. The U.S. Department of Energy reports that households can save between $200 to $800 annually on energy bills. However, initial installation costs may deter potential buyers. Some consumers may hesitate due to installation complexities and varying local regulations.
While the benefits are clear, challenges persist. Market fluctuations and component availability can affect pricing. Some installations may not see immediate returns, causing frustration. Assessing the local climate and specific energy needs is crucial. Miscalculations can lead to underperformance. As the market evolves, ongoing education and transparency will be vital to ensure that buyers make informed decisions about solar thermal technology.
